Evidence-Based Practices: The Heart of Strategy Development

Have you ever heard the term "evidence-based practices"? This buzzword isn’t just jargon; it means relying on data and scientific findings to make informed decisions about pest management strategies. In short, it’s about using facts rather than guesswork or outdated methods.

For instance, research has led to the development of Integrated Pest Management (IPM) approaches, which combine various techniques—like biological, cultural, and chemical control—into a cohesive strategy. By collaborating these methods, we avoid over-relying on a single treatment and consequently reduce the chances of pests developing resistance. It’s a little like having a toolbox for different home repairs; you wouldn’t just rely on a hammer for everything, right? Similarly, IPM gives us a toolbox of techniques to tackle pest problems wisely.

Innovations That Move Us Forward

What happens when research leads to innovation? We see breakthroughs in pest management techniques that improve our quality of life. For example, advances in biopesticides—natural substances that control pests—arise from research into the natural enemy relationships within ecosystems, offering a less harmful alternative to traditional synthetic pesticides.
